Output 1968074c582a62dd8ec78eee1c21975df1a507c8b1e720551cdd312fd2a624aa:0

value
21142973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b64ec3508a3a47caedeebc944e9a78730230f33 OP_EQUAL
address
3CwTwNQh8sK2wrXVc49YkioeYhrK6vSwyW
transaction
1968074c582a62dd8ec78eee1c21975df1a507c8b1e720551cdd312fd2a624aa
spent
true